Gigglegirl, a few things you will need to watch out for:
-oil consumption, check at least every 500 miles
-cylinder head cracking on S*1's (SOHC motors)
-hard transmission shifting into reverse; a pair of nuts in the transmission are known to loosen on some trannies and should be repaired ASAP if you get that
-ignition coil packs are a common source of ignition trouble
Cheap to fix and easy to work on are it's best attributes, as well as getting pretty decent mileage and not having to worry about dents.
